H2: Absence of a defined process for handling alerts

Handling real-time alerts calls for a defined, well-oiled process. Too often, alerts are left unattended or dealt with haphazardly due to the lack of a clear, structured process. This not only prolongs the response time but also increases the chances of significant damage by the time the issue is finally addressed.

Without a standardized incident response process, the risk of security breaches increases significantly. A study by Ponemon Institute in 2018 found that 47% of businesses lack this crucial component. Having such a system in place streamlines response times and improves overall security measures.

The major mistake here is the absence of a proper process to manage and address security alerts. To counteract this, create minimum standards for response times to distinct classes of alerts. For instance, the fallout from Yahoo's massive data breach in 2013 might have been mitigated if a proper alert handling process was in place.

Having a structural process can be a game-changer in efficiently managing security incidents.

H2: Over reliance on default settings

Default settings are often basic and do not cater to the specific security needs of your database. While they offer a good starting point, these settings need to be tailored to meet the unique security demands of the database and improve the detection of possible threats.

This nuance is especially critical, as a report by Tripwire found that 62% of IT professionals admitted to not changing default administrative passwords. This showcases the prevalent over-reliance on default settings among professionals.

The mistake in this situation is being overly reliant on these basic settings. It is crucial to customize your security settings based on the demand and nature of the information stored in your database. Recall the Mirai botnet attack in 2016 that exploited devices still using default credentials.

Relying solely on default settings is as good as leaving your front door unlocked. To maintain the integrity of your database, make sure that you customize and regularly update the settings.
